Baked Rice Broccoli

Recipe

Title: BAKED RICE BROCCOLI
Categories: Vegetables, Rice, Casseroles
Yield: 6 servings

2 c Rice; cooked
1/2 c Butter
1/2 c Onion; chopped
1/2 c Celery; chopped
1 cn Cream of mushroom soup
2 pk Frozen chopped broccoli; tha
Not cook
1 cn Water chestnuts; drain; chop
1 c Velvetta cheese; cubed

Melt butter in saucepan. Saute onion and celery in butter. Mix in a
big bow cooked rice, onions, celery, broccoli, soup, water chestnuts
and cheese. Mix all togethera nd put in a 9×13″ casserole dish. Cover
with foil and bake for 25-30 minutes at 350~.

ORANGE CHEESECAKE AND STRAWBERRIES

Recipe By :
Serving Size : 12 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Cheesecakes Fruits

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
—–BEST RECIPE MAGAZINE-APRIL—–
—–THE LIGHT TOUCH COOKBOOK—–
—–CRUST—–
1 cup Finely crushed vanilla wafer
1 1/2 teaspoon Ground cinnamon
1 tablespoon Egg white
Vegetable-oil cooking spray
—–CHEESECAKE—–
16 ounce Low-fat cottage cheese
8 ounce Neufchatel cheese — room temp*
1/3 cup Sugar
1 tablespoon Flour
2 tablespoon Orange juice
1 1/2 teaspoon Grated orange zest
1 teaspoon Vanilla
1 lg Navel orange — sectioned
membranes removed
1 pint Ripe strawberries — slice thin

Preheat oven to 350 F. Combine the vanilla wafer and cinnmon in a bowl. In a
separate bowl, whisk the egg white until foamy, blend it into the crumbs with
a fork. Spray a 9-inch springform pan with a vegetable-oil cooking spray.
press the crumbs in an even layer in the bottom of the prepared pan. Bake 10
minutes. Cool. reduce the oven temperature to 300 F.

In the bowl of a food processor, combine the cottage cheese, cream cheese,
sugar, flour, orange juice, orange zest and vanilla extract until very smooth.
Spoon into the prepared crust and smooth the top with a rubber spatula. Bake
until set in the center, about 35-40 minutes. Cool in the pan.

Refrigerate until cold. Loosen the sides of the cake with a small rubber
spatula and remove the pan rim.

Combine the orange sections and strawberries. Cut the cheesecake into thin
wedges and spoon some fruit on each serving. Makes 12 servings with 137
calories per serving.

Di Saronno Sour

Recipe

Di Saronno Sour

Recipe By : Di Saronno
Serving Size : 1 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Drinks, Alcoholic Liqueur

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
1 1/2 ounces Di Saronno Amaretto
1 ounce lemon juice
1 teaspoon sugar
ice
1 each orange slice

Pour ingredients into cocktail shaker with cracked ice. Shake well, strain
into sour glass. Garnish with orange slice.

English Toffee Balls

Recipe

ENGLISH TOFFEE BALLS

Recipe By : Pillsbury
Serving Size : 72 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Cookies Bars

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
1/2 cup powdered sugar
1 cup butter or margarine — softened
1 package vanilla instant pudding and pie filling — (3 1/2
ounce)
2 cups all-purpose flour
1 tablespoon milk
1 teaspoon vanilla
3 bars chocolate coated English toffee — (3/4 ounce each)
powdered sugar

Heat oven to 325F degrees. In large bowl, cream powdered sugar, butter and
pudding mix. Lightly spoon flour into measuring cup; level off. Stir flour,
milk, vanilla and crushed toffee bars into creamed mixture; mix well. Shape
dough into 1″ balls. Place on ungreased cookie sheets. Bake for 13-18
minutes or until edges are light golden brown. Cool. Dip top of cookie in
powdered sugar.

– –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– – –

NOTES : English toffee candy bars add a special flavor and texture.

Hearty Vegetable Barley Soup

Recipe By :
Serving Size : 6 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Soups

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
4 ounces Lean ground beef
1/4 cup Chopped onion
1 Garlic cloves — minced
1 3/4 pints Water
1/2 pound No-salt-added tomatoes
— undrained — chopped
1/4 cup Medium QUAKER Barley*
1/4 cup Sliced celery
1/4 cup Sliced carrots
1 Beef bouillon cubes
1/2 teaspoon Basil
1/2 Bay leaf
1 dash Black pepper
4 1/2 ounces Frozen mixed vegetables

In 4-quart saucepan or Dutch oven, brown ground beef. Add onion and
garlic. Cook until onion is tender; drain. Add remaining ingredients
except frozen vegetables.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low; cover.
Simmer 40 minutes, stirring occasionally. Add frozen vegetables; cook 10
to 15 minutes or until vegetables and barley are tender. Add additional
water if soup becomes too thick upon standing.

Ten 1-cup servings
*NOTE: To use Quick QUAKER Barley, substitute 2/3 cup quick barley for
medium barley and decrease water to 6 cups. Cook ground beef, onion and
garlic as directed above. Add remaining ingredients including frozen
vegetables.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low; cover. Simmer 15 to 20
minutes or until vegetables and barley are tender.

Nutrition Information: 1 cup * Calories 110 * Protein 7g * Carbohydrate
15g * Fat 3g * Cholesterol 15mg * Dietary Fiber 2g * Sodium 190mg *
Percent of Calories from Fat: 25%
Exchanges: Starch/Bread 1/2, Meat 1/2, Vegetable 1-1/2

Fresh Strawberry Pie

Recipe

Title: Fresh Strawberry Pie
Categories: Desserts, Pies
Yield: 6 servings

1 Baked 9-inch Pie Shell
1 1/4 c Sugar
1 tb Cornstarch
3 tb Lemon Juice
3 oz (1 Pk) Strawberry Gelatin
1 qt Fresh Strawberries
1 1/2 c Water

Clean and hull strawberries. In medium saucepan, combine sugar and
cornstarch; add water and lemon juice. Over high heat, bring to a
boil. Reduce heat; cook and stir until slightly thickened and clear,
4 to 5 minutes. Add gelatin, stir until dissolved. Cool to room
temperature. Stir in strawberries; turn into prepared pastry shell.
Chill 4 to 6 hours or until set. Serve with whipped cream if
desired. Refrigerate leftovers.

Chickpea Curry

Recipe

CHICKPEA CURRY

Recipe By :
Serving Size : 4 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Main Dish Indian
Vegetarian

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
1 c Cooked chickpeas
2 lg Onions
2 ea Dried red chilies
1/4 lb Ginger
3 ea Garlic cloves
1/2 ts Mustard powder
1 t Cumin
1/2 ts Turmeric
1/4 ts Cinnamon
2 tb Vegetable oil
Salt, to taste
1 md Tomato

Peel and cut onion. Cut ginger into small pieces.
Put these ingredients, along with garlic cloves,
mustard powder, and cumin powder in a blender. Blend
into a paste.

Cut tomato into small pieces.

Over a medium heat add oil to a pan. Saute the
condiments.

When the spices become thick add cut tomato. Stir and
cook for 5 minutes.

Add cooked chickpeas. Turn over contents of pan. Add
2 tablespoons of water and salt. Add cinnamon powder
and turmeric powder. Stir the pan. Cook for 8 to 10
minutes.

Serve hot or warm.

Apple Walnut Stuffing

Recipe

APPLE WALNUT STUFFING

Recipe By :
Serving Size : 1 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Side dish

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
8 c Bread, cut into 1″ cubes
1/4 c Butter or margarine
1/2 c Diced onion
1/4 c Fresh parsley
2 Eggs
1 c Chicken broth
1/4 ts Pepper
2 Peeled cored diced apples
1 c Chopped walnuts

Preheat your oven to 325 degrees. Place bread cubes
in a large bowl. Melt the butter in a medium skillet
over medium heat. Chop the parsley. Add celery, onion
and parsley to the butter and cook, stirring
occasionally, until softened. This should take about
five minutes. Mix all this with the bread. Now beat
the eggs. Mix eggs, broth and pepper; add this to the
bread and mix it all real well. Stir in apples and
walnuts. Bake in greased 2-quart dish for 25 minutes.
If you like your stuffing a little crispy, go ahead
and cook it for a little longer. When it’s done, serve
it up! This one’ll go quick, and if your kin likes
stuffing as much as mine, you may want to double all
the ingredients to make a little extra for the day

Oatmeal Gingerbread (Scottish)

Recipe By :
Serving Size : 4 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Cakes

Amount Measure Ingredient — Preparation Method
——– ———— ——————————–
6 oz Flour
2 oz Oatmea!
2 oz Soft brown sugar
2 oz Butter
2 tb Black treacle
1 t Ground ginger
1 t Mixed spice
1 lg Egg, beaten
1 t Level bicarbonate soda
3 tb Milk

Set oven to 350F or Mark 4. Line a 7 inch square
baking tin with buttered greaseproof paper. Put the
butter, sugar and treacle together in a saucepan and
heat gently until the fat melts. Sieve the flour and
bicarbonate of soda into a bowl and add the oatmeal,
sugar and spices. Add the melted treacle mixture, the
beaten egg and the milk. Stir well until blended. Pour
into the tin and bake for about 45 minutes. Cool in
the tin for about 10 minutes then turn out on to a
wire rack.

From the booklet Scottish Teatime Recipes
